Editorial Board
- IEEE Wireless Communications Letters: Associate Editor
- Network: Editorial Board Member
Steering and Organizing Committee
- ICC 2025: Session Chair “SAC-ISAC-04: Integrated Sensing & Communications“
- Berlin 6G Conference 2025: Workshop Chair “2nd Workshop on Security, Privacy, and Resilience of Next-Generation Mobile Networks”
- ECCWS 2025: Conference Co-Chair
- WCNC 2024: Session Chair “UAV Communications and Control”
- PIMRC 2024: Workshop Chair “WS 12 – Workshop on Industrial Wireless Networks 2024“
- CNS 2024: Workshop Chair “1st Workshop on Security, Privacy, and Resilience of Next-Generation Mobile Networks”
- ICC 2023: Session Chair “Energy-efficient Design for Green Ad Hoc, Sensor and IoT Networks” and “Protocols, Architectures and Applications for IoT I”
- EW 2022: Special Session Chair “Reconfigurable Intelligent Surfaces”
- ITC 34: Workshop Chair “Smart Industrial Networking in B5G/6G”
- NGNA 2020-2023: TPC Chair
- GLOBECOM 2017: Session Chair “M2M Communication and IoT”
Technical Program Committee
- GLOBECOM 2018
- ICC 2020-2025
- WCNC 2024
- EuCNC 2018-2025
- EW 2018-2025
- VCC 2023-2025
- FNWF 2024
- ARES 2023
Reviewer
- IEEE Journal on Selected Areas in Communications
- IEEE Internet of Things Journal
- IEEE Wireless Comunications Magazine
- IEEE Communications Magazine
- IEEE Vehicular Technology Magazine
- IEEE Communications Standards Magazine
- ACM Computing Surveys
- IEEE Transactions on Wireless Communications
- IEEE Transactions on Communications
- IEEE Transactions on Mobile Computing
- IEEE Transactions on Dependable and Secure Computing
- IEEE Transactions on Microwave Theory and Techniques
- IEEE Transactions on Vehicular Technology
- IEEE Transactions on Cognitive Communications and Networking
- IEEE Transactions on Network and Service Management
- IEEE Transactions on Network Science and Engineering
- IEEE Transactions on Learning Technologies
- IEEE Transactions on Artificial Intelligence
- IEEE Wireless Communications Letters

- IEEE Communications Letters
- IEEE Networking Letters
- IEEE Access
- Sensors
- Computer Networks

- Digital Signal Processing

- Entropy
- Electronics
- Physical Communication

- International Journal of Communication Systems
- Wireless Communications and Mobile Computing